After selecting your device, Amazon will ask a few qualifying questions about its condition to provide an accurate appraisal. It may ask whether the device powers on and holds a charge, if all accessories are included, and whether there are any cracks or defects. You’ll also need to confirm the overall condition of the device.
Be as honest and accurate as possible, because Amazon’s inspectors will verify your answers. If the condition doesn’t match your description, Amazon will adjust the trade-in offer….
